Aruya is a name believed to originate from Central Asian and Turkic roots, meaning 'noble' or 'peaceful'. It combines elements that suggest brightness and serenity, often interpreted as 'bringer of light' or 'harmonious spirit'. Historically, it has been used in various nomadic cultures, symbolizing purity and balance in nature.

Cultural Significance of Aruya

In Turkic and Central Asian cultures, Aruya symbolizes nobility and peace, often chosen for children to represent hope and harmony. It reflects a deep respect for nature and balance, frequently appearing in folk tales as a name for characters embodying light or tranquility. Its unisex usage highlights the cultural emphasis on balance and equality.
